PMI Announces Its National Conference for Healthcare Professionals to be Held In San Antonio, Texas

[ClickPress, Thu Jan 26 2006] PMI (Practice Management Institute), a leading provider of medical office continuing education, announces it’s National Conference for Healthcare Professionals will be held on May 18 & 19, 2006 in San Antonio, TX.

“This conference is jam-packed with information critical to the physician’s office. Topics such as: ‘EMRs – Should you Implement a Paperless System?’, ‘Pay For Performance and Consumer Driven Healthcare’ and ‘Making Sense of the New Competitive Acquisition Plan’ highlight issues affecting the physicians practice in 2006” says Lynn Ballard, Conference Chair.

Guest presenters include Stan Luke, Deputy Chief, U.S. District Attorney’s Office, Civil Division Department of Justice and Michael Brown, Editorial Consultant for Medical Economics. Round table discussions, customized breakout sessions and networking luncheons are designed to promote group interaction with conference participants and faculty members.

For 25 years PMI has taught physicians and medical office professionals the latest in coding, reimbursement and practice management. PMI classes are currently presented in 400 of the nation’s leading hospitals, health care systems, colleges and medical societies. PMI also provides the following three professionals certifications: Certified Medical Coder (CMC), Certified Medical Office Manager (CMOM), and Certified Medical Insurance Specialist (CMIS).

In 2004, the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S) named PMI, along with AHIMA and AAPC as example coder certification programs that could be utilized to fulfill its coding certification requirement of Medicare Contractors. The requirement stems from implementation guidelines for the Medicare Prescription Drug, Improvement and modernization Act of 2003 (MMA). This recognition reinforces PMI’s position as a top three provider of certification for medical office staff.
